Skip to content

요구사항분석

woorimIT edited this page Jun 16, 2021 · 3 revisions

요구사항분석

  1. 메인화면에는 ToDo를 등록하는 Add a list 박스가 기본적으로 존재한다.
    스크린샷 2021-06-15 오후 11 44 13

  2. Add a list 박스를 클릭하면 새로운 List Title 등록 폼이 생긴다.
    각 등록 폼에는 Add a list 인풋과 Save, X 버튼이 존재한다.
    스크린샷 2021-06-15 오후 11 44 45

    • Enter를 누르면 Save 버튼이 클릭되어야 한다.
  3. Save 버튼이 클릭되면 입력된 List Title이 추가되고, 새로운 List Title 등록 폼이 생긴다.
    스크린샷 2021-06-16 오전 12 01 23

    • 추가된 List Title에는 Add a card 버튼이 존재해야 한다.
    • List Title 등록 폼의 외부, 즉 바탕화면을 선택하면 등록 폼이 사라지고 Add a list 인풋으로 전환되어야 한다.
      스크린샷 2021-06-16 오전 12 07 48
  4. Add a card를 클릭하면 새로운 Card 등록 폼이 생긴다.
    각 등록 폼에는 empty 인풋(textarea)과 Add, X 버튼이 존재한다.
    스크린샷 2021-06-16 오전 12 13 36

    • Enter를 누르면 Add 버튼이 클릭되어야 한다.
  5. Add 버튼이 클릭되면 입력된 Card가 추가되고, 새로운 Card 등록 폼이 생긴다.
    스크린샷 2021-06-16 오전 12 22 58

  6. Cardhover(마우스가 가리키고 있는) 상태라면 우측에 수정 아이콘 버튼이 보이도록 한다.
    스크린샷 2021-06-16 오전 12 31 09

  7. Drag & Drop을 통해 각 Card를 원하는 위치로 이동시킬 수 있다.
    스크린샷 2021-06-16 오전 12 32 23

    • 서로 다른 List 폼에서도 Card 이동이 가능하다.
      스크린샷 2021-06-16 오전 12 33 37
  8. (공통) X 버튼을 클릭하면 등록 폼은 사라진다.
    스크린샷 2021-06-16 오전 12 36 49 -> 스크린샷 2021-06-16 오전 12 36 58

Clone this wiki locally